Speaker Circuit
DESCRIPTION
The sound signal that has been amplified by the stereo component amplifier is sent to the speakers from the stereo component amplifier through this circuit.
If there is a short in this circuit, the stereo component amplifier detects it and stops output to the speakers.
Thus sound cannot be heard from the speakers even if there is no malfunction in the stereo component amplifier or speakers.
When a short is detected in the speaker circuit, no sound can be heard from the speakers.

INSPECTION PROCEDURE
PROCEDURE
1. CHECK HARNESS AND CONNECTOR
(a) Disconnect the connectors shown in the illustration on the left from the stereo component amplifier and speakers.
(b) Measure the resistance between the front No. 2 speakers and the stereo component amplifier to check for an open circuit in the wire harness.
Standard resistance:
Below 1 Ohms
(c) Measure the resistance between rear speakers and the stereo component amplifier to check for an open circuit in the wire harness.
Standard resistance:
Below 1 Ohms
(d) Measure the resistance between the front stereo component speaker and the stereo component amplifier to check for an open circuit in the wire harness.
Standard resistance:
Below 1 Ohms
(e) Measure the resistance between the woofer box speaker and the stereo component amplifier to check for an open circuit in the wire harness.
Standard resistance:
Below 1 Ohms
(f) Measure the resistance between the front No. 1 speaker and the front No. 2 speaker to check for an open circuit in the wire harness.
Standard resistance:
Below 1 Ohms
(g) Measure the resistance between each speaker and body ground to check for a short circuit in the wire harness.
Standard resistance:
10 kOhms or higher
NG -- REPAIR OR REPLACE HARNESS OR CONNECTOR
OK -- Continue to next step.

3. INSPECT FRONT NO. 1 SPEAKER
(a) Resistance check.
(1) Measure the resistance between the terminals of the speaker.
Standard resistance:
4 to 6 Ohms
NG -- REPLACE FRONT NO. 1 SPEAKER
OK -- Continue to next step.
4. INSPECT FRONT NO. 2 SPEAKER
(a) Check that the malfunction disappears when another speaker in good condition is installed.
OK:
Malfunction disappears.
HINT:
- Connect all the connectors to the front No. 2 speakers.
- When there is a possibility that either right or left front speaker is defective, inspect by interchanging the right one with the left one.
OK -- REPLACE FRONT NO. 2 SPEAKER
NG -- Continue to next step.
5. INSPECT REAR SPEAKER
(a) Resistance check.
(1) Measure the resistance between the terminals of the speaker.
Standard resistance:
Approximately 2.6 Ohms
NG -- REPLACE REAR SPEAKER
OK -- Continue to next step.
6. INSPECT FRONT STEREO COMPONENT SPEAKER
(a) Resistance check.
(1) Measure the resistance between the terminals of the speaker.
Standard resistance:
1.2 to 2.2 Ohms
NG -- REPLACE FRONT STEREO COMPONENT SPEAKER
OK -- PROCEED TO NEXT CIRCUIT INSPECTION SHOWN IN PROBLEM SYMPTOMS TABLE
